Quality assurance specialist - united states, jamestown (new york)

adecco creative & marketing is looking for a quality assurance specialist/controller for one of the most recognizable jewelry houses in the world. in this role you will be responsible for examining all incoming and outgoing client and stock repairs, as well as some administrative tasks.

 

if you are looking for a tight-knit, diverse, team oriented position with an iconic luxury brand, you should apply! this is a trained position, you do not need to have any experience with jewelry repairs or gemstones. 9-5, m-f, overtime available.

 

responisiblities:

diagnosis

  • examine all client and stock repairs to assess what type of repair service is needed
  • systematically update the information in the system and enter the item conditions, repair details, and cost estimate in sap using the proper system codes, while ensuring adherence to the lead time established by the brand
  • ensure all gemstones are matching from the original mounting, naturality, and any physical damage of the stones
  • ensure counterfeit or non-original items are reported in the system
  •  

    quality control

  • examine completed repaired merchandise to verify that the servicing has been completed in accordance with the request
  • examine manufactured stock merchandise to verify they are in accordance with the brand's quality standards
  • examine gems stones from the diagnosis report
  • record quality issues in sap and notify the applicable department
